 Cationic polyelectrolyte using processes:
 1, granular polyelectrolyte flocculant agent cannot directly in 
			addition to sewage. It must first be dissolved in water before use, 
			using its aqueous solution to wastewater treatment.
 
 2 water should be clean, dissolving granular polymer (such as 
			water), and cannot be a sewage. Water at room temperature, typically 
			do not require heating. Water temperatures below 5 ° c are dissolved 
			very slowly. Dissolved water temperature increase faster, but more 
			than 40 ° c causes the accelerated degradation of polymers, effect 
			using the effect. Tap water is suitable for the preparation of 
			polymer solution in General. Strong acid, alkali, salt-laden water 
			is not fit for the preparation.
 
 3, selection of polymer solution concentration, company recommends 
			to 0.1% per cent, that is, 1 liter of water and 1g-3G in polymer 
			powder. Polyelectrolyte concentration options to take into account 
			the following factors: Preparation tank is small and large amount of 
			medication every day, proposed grading of slightly dense (such as 
			0.3%). Polymer molecular weight is high, slightly dilute some of the 
			proposed distribution (such as 0.1%). In polymer solutions into the 
			sewage, such as dispersed when the situation is not very good for 
			equipment reasons, recommends slightly dilute some of the 
			distribution. In short, polymer concentration too large will cause 
			agitator motor load is too large, can also cause after entering the 
			water dispersing condition is not good, affect the results. Worthy 
			of dilute some help to increase the effect.
